Aug 11, 2016
Several waves of thunderstorms that moved across southern Minnesota, and into west central Wisconsin between the late afternoon of Wednesday, August 10th, through Thursday morning, August 11th, caused damage near Ellsworth. Flash flooding also occurred along the Pepin, Buffalo, Trempealeau, and Eau Claire Counties lines. The worst flood areas were in Buffalo and Trempealeau Counties, but road closures and detours were noted along the county borders.
